Clement Arroga resigns as coach of Panthere amid tensions, unpaid salary

Yves Clement Arroga has stepped down from his position as head coach of Elite one club Panthere Sportive of Nde, after a year plus at the helm.

The experience and former intermediate Lions and Dynamo of Douala tactician, cited misunderstandings, interference in his technical choices and management as primary reasons for his resignation, adding that three months of unpaid salaries (January-March 2026) and other bonuses are contributing factors.

In letter to the Club’s hierarchy dated March 31, Arroga stated

“𝙄 𝙩𝙝𝙖𝙣𝙠 𝙖𝙡𝙡 𝙩𝙝𝙚 𝙨𝙪𝙥𝙥𝙤𝙧𝙩𝙚𝙧𝙨 𝙤𝙛 𝙋𝙖𝙣𝙩𝙝è𝙧𝙚 𝙎𝙥𝙤𝙧𝙩𝙞𝙫𝙚 𝙙𝙪 𝙉𝘿𝙀 𝙖𝙣𝙙 𝙩𝙝𝙚 𝙧𝙚𝙨𝙩 𝙤𝙛 𝙩𝙝𝙚 𝙩𝙚𝙖𝙢. 𝙒𝙚 𝙢𝙖𝙙𝙚 𝙖𝙣 𝙚𝙣𝙩𝙞𝙧𝙚 𝘿𝙞𝙫𝙞𝙨𝙞𝙤𝙣 𝙖𝙣𝙙 𝙚𝙫𝙚𝙣 𝙩𝙝𝙚 𝙒𝙚𝙨𝙩 𝙍𝙚𝙜𝙞𝙤𝙣 𝙙𝙧𝙚𝙖𝙢. 𝙏𝙝𝙖𝙣𝙠𝙨 𝙩𝙤 𝙖𝙡𝙡 𝙩𝙝𝙚 𝙥𝙡𝙖𝙮𝙚𝙧𝙨 𝙬𝙝𝙤 𝙖𝙘𝙘𝙚𝙥𝙩𝙚𝙙 𝙩𝙤 𝙨𝙪𝙛𝙛𝙚𝙧 𝙬𝙞𝙩𝙝 𝙩𝙝𝙚𝙨𝙚 𝙥𝙧𝙞𝙣𝙘𝙞𝙥𝙡𝙚𝙨 𝙖𝙣𝙙 𝙧𝙚𝙦𝙪𝙞𝙧𝙚𝙢𝙚𝙣𝙩𝙨. 𝙏𝙝𝙖𝙣𝙠 𝙮𝙤𝙪 𝙩𝙤 𝙩𝙝𝙚 𝙢𝙚𝙢𝙗𝙚𝙧𝙨 𝙤𝙛 𝙋𝙖𝙣𝙩𝙝è𝙧𝙚, 𝙛𝙤𝙧 𝙧𝙚𝙘𝙤𝙜𝙣𝙞𝙯𝙞𝙣𝙜 𝙤𝙪𝙧 𝙥𝙧𝙤𝙛𝙚𝙨𝙨𝙞𝙤𝙣 𝙖𝙣𝙙 𝙧𝙚𝙦𝙪𝙞𝙧𝙞𝙣𝙜 𝙪𝙨 𝙩𝙤 𝙖𝙡𝙬𝙖𝙮𝙨 𝙝𝙖𝙫𝙚 𝙤𝙪𝙧 𝙨𝙪𝙞𝙩𝙘𝙖𝙨𝙚𝙨 𝙧𝙚𝙖𝙙𝙮 𝙩𝙤 𝙡𝙚𝙖𝙫𝙚 𝙬𝙝𝙚𝙣 𝙩𝙝𝙞𝙣𝙜𝙨 𝙖𝙧𝙚𝙣’𝙩 𝙜𝙤𝙞𝙣𝙜 𝙬𝙚𝙡𝙡. 𝙒𝙝𝙚𝙣 𝙥𝙚𝙧𝙛𝙤𝙧𝙢𝙖𝙣𝙘𝙚 𝙘𝙝𝙖𝙣𝙣𝙚𝙡𝙨 𝙖𝙧𝙚 𝙖𝙩𝙩𝙖𝙘𝙠𝙚𝙙 𝙗𝙮 𝙢𝙞𝙨𝙪𝙣𝙙𝙚𝙧𝙨𝙩𝙖𝙣𝙙𝙞𝙣𝙜, 𝙙𝙞𝙘𝙩𝙖𝙩𝙤𝙧𝙨𝙝𝙞𝙥 𝙚𝙢𝙖𝙣𝙖𝙩𝙞𝙣𝙜 𝙛𝙧𝙤𝙢 𝙩𝙝𝙚 𝙋𝘾𝘼, 𝙖𝙣𝙙 𝙞𝙣𝙩𝙚𝙧𝙛𝙚𝙧𝙚𝙣𝙘𝙚 𝙞𝙣 𝙩𝙝𝙚 𝙩𝙚𝙘𝙝𝙣𝙞𝙘𝙖𝙡 𝙙𝙚𝙘𝙞𝙨𝙞𝙤𝙣𝙨 𝙤𝙛 𝙩𝙝𝙚 𝙨𝙩𝙖𝙛𝙛 𝙖𝙩 𝙩𝙝𝙞𝙨 𝙩𝙞𝙢𝙚, 𝙧𝙚𝙨𝙪𝙡𝙩𝙨 𝙘𝙖𝙣𝙣𝙤𝙩 𝙛𝙤𝙡𝙡𝙤𝙬. 𝙏𝙝𝙞𝙨 𝙗𝙚𝙞𝙣𝙜 𝙨𝙖𝙞𝙙, 𝙄 𝙝𝙖𝙫𝙚 𝙙𝙚𝙘𝙞𝙙𝙚𝙙 𝙩𝙤 𝙧𝙚𝙨𝙞𝙜𝙣 𝙛𝙧𝙤𝙢 𝙢𝙮 𝙥𝙤𝙨𝙞𝙩𝙞𝙤𝙣 𝙖𝙨 𝙝𝙚𝙖𝙙 𝙘𝙤𝙖𝙘𝙝 𝙤𝙛 𝙋𝙖𝙣𝙩𝙝è𝙧𝙚 𝙎𝙥𝙤𝙧𝙩𝙞𝙫𝙚 𝘿𝙪 𝙉𝙙𝙚, 𝙬𝙞𝙩𝙝 𝙖 𝙘𝙡𝙖𝙞𝙢 𝙛𝙤𝙧 𝙩𝙝𝙧𝙚𝙚 (03) 𝙢𝙤𝙣𝙩𝙝𝙨 𝙤𝙛 𝙨𝙖𝙡𝙖𝙧𝙮, 𝙣𝙖𝙢𝙚𝙡𝙮 𝙅𝙖𝙣𝙪𝙖𝙧𝙮, 𝙁𝙚𝙗𝙧𝙪𝙖𝙧𝙮, 𝙖𝙣𝙙 𝙈𝙖𝙧𝙘𝙝 2026, 𝙖𝙣𝙙 𝙤𝙩𝙝𝙚𝙧 𝙥𝙖𝙮𝙢𝙚𝙣𝙩𝙨”

His resignation marks the end of a successful stay at the west region-based club, after arriving at a crucial moment when the club was slowly sinking and he helped revive the club and eventually finished vice champions same year of experiencing that crisis.

Under his leadership, Panthere not only finished second in the MTN Elite One championship but won the Cameroon Cup and just recently backed another trophy( Cameroon Super Cup) though off the pitch.

A historic 2024-2025 year, considered the best in the club’s history and as new coach his ambitions were clear: to raise this team among the best in Cameroon and, why not and bring back glory days.

However, Panthère Sportive of Nde have not had a fine run in the league this season.
They are currently ranked 10th in the Elite one championship, with just 12 points recorded from 11 games.
